当前位置: 首页 > news >正文

5分钟快速找回压缩包密码!开源工具ArchivePasswordTestTool终极指南 [特殊字符]

5分钟快速找回压缩包密码!开源工具ArchivePasswordTestTool终极指南 🚀

【免费下载链接】ArchivePasswordTestTool利用7zip测试压缩包的功能 对加密压缩包进行自动化测试密码项目地址: https://gitcode.com/gh_mirrors/ar/ArchivePasswordTestTool

你是否曾经遇到过这种情况:重要的压缩文件设置了密码,时间一长却完全忘记了密码是什么?那种焦急和无奈的感觉,相信每个电脑用户都深有体会。今天我要为你介绍一款开源神器——ArchivePasswordTestTool,它能帮你快速找回遗忘的压缩包密码,支持ZIP、RAR、7z等多种格式,而且是完全免费的!😊

为什么你需要这个密码恢复工具?

想象一下这些场景:

  • 家庭照片备份:多年前加密的家庭照片,现在想重温却忘了密码
  • 工作文档交接:前同事留下的加密项目文件,没有密码交接记录
  • 个人资料整理:自己设置的复杂密码,时间久了完全想不起来

ArchivePasswordTestTool的锁形图标象征着安全与数据恢复功能

传统的手动尝试方法效率极低,而商业软件又价格昂贵。ArchivePasswordTestTool的出现,完美解决了这个痛点!它利用7zip的强大功能,结合智能字典测试技术,让你在几分钟内就能找回密码。

📋 快速诊断:这个工具适合你吗?

适用场景检查表: ✅ 你拥有文件的合法访问权限 ✅ 密码是你自己设置但忘记了 ✅ 文件格式为ZIP、RAR或7z ✅ 你需要一个免费、开源的解决方案

不适用场景: ❌ 试图破解他人加密文件 ❌ 用于非法目的 ❌ 文件使用非标准加密算法

🚀 快速开始:5分钟上手教程

环境准备(超简单!)

  1. 安装.NET运行环境(如果你还没有的话)

  2. 克隆项目仓库

    git clone https://gitcode.com/gh_mirrors/ar/ArchivePasswordTestTool cd ArchivePasswordTestTool
  3. 构建项目

    dotnet build

就是这么简单!ArchivePasswordTestTool会自动检测并引导你安装所需的7zip组件。

核心功能实战演示

基础使用流程

# 运行工具测试压缩包密码 dotnet run --project ArchivePasswordTestTool/ArchivePasswordTestTool.csproj \ -- --target "你的加密文件.zip" \ --dictionary "密码字典.txt"

小贴士:首次使用时,工具会自动创建默认的密码字典文件,你也可以根据自己的情况创建个性化字典。

🎯 构建高效密码字典的秘诀

密码字典的质量直接决定了恢复速度!下面是我总结的几种高效字典构建方法:

1. 个人信息组合法

  • 姓名拼音 + 生日(如:zhangsan19900101)
  • 电话号码 + 姓名缩写
  • 常用昵称 + 特殊数字

2. 常用模式变形法

  • 大小写变化尝试(Password → password → PASSWORD)
  • 数字替换字母(o→0, i→1, e→3)
  • 添加特殊符号(在密码前后加!@#等)

3. 日期格式全覆盖

别忘了尝试各种日期格式:

  • YYYYMMDD(20230101)
  • DDMMYYYY(01012023)
  • MM-DD-YYYY(01-01-2023)
  • YYMMDD(230101)

⚡ 性能优化:让密码恢复速度飞起来

多线程并行处理

ArchivePasswordTestTool支持多线程测试,你可以根据电脑配置调整线程数:

# 使用8个线程并行测试(适合8核CPU) dotnet run --project ArchivePasswordTestTool/ArchivePasswordTestTool.csproj \ -- --target "大文件.rar" \ --dictionary "综合字典.txt" \ --threads 8

断点续传功能

对于大型文件或复杂密码,测试可能需要较长时间。别担心!工具支持进度保存:

# 保存测试进度 dotnet run --project ArchivePasswordTestTool/ArchivePasswordTestTool.csproj \ -- --save-progress "进度文件.json" # 从上次中断处继续 dotnet run --project ArchivePasswordTestTool/ArchivePasswordTestTool.csproj \ -- --resume "进度文件.json"

📊 工具优势对比表

特性ArchivePasswordTestTool手动尝试商业软件
价格完全免费免费但耗时昂贵(通常$50+)
速度极快(多线程)极慢
易用性命令行,简单直接繁琐图形界面
自定义完全开源可修改有限
安全性本地运行,数据不外泄安全依赖厂商

🔧 技术架构揭秘

ArchivePasswordTestTool的核心设计非常精妙:

核心源码分析

主程序逻辑:ArchivePasswordTestTool/Program.cs

  • 多线程调度管理:智能分配测试任务
  • 7zip命令行接口封装:无缝调用系统功能
  • 进度跟踪与报告:实时显示测试状态

工具函数库:ArchivePasswordTestTool/Utils.cs

  • 文件操作辅助:安全处理各种文件格式
  • 配置管理:保存用户偏好设置
  • 错误处理机制:优雅处理各种异常情况

项目配置:ArchivePasswordTestTool/Properties/launchSettings.json

  • 开发环境配置
  • 调试参数设置
  • 运行环境优化

🚨 避坑指南:常见问题与解决方案

问题1:工具无法识别压缩文件

解决方案

  • 确保文件扩展名正确(.zip, .rar, .7z)
  • 检查文件是否损坏
  • 确认系统已安装最新版7zip

问题2:测试速度过慢

优化建议

  1. 精简密码字典,移除明显不可能的密码
  2. 调整线程数,避免资源竞争
  3. 使用SSD硬盘提升I/O性能

问题3:内存占用过高

处理方法

  • 工具支持流式读取大字典文件
  • 可分割大字典为多个小文件分批测试
  • 调整缓冲区大小控制内存使用

💡 专业建议:提高密码恢复成功率

创建"智能"密码字典

不要使用随机的密码列表!根据文件创建时间、文件内容、你的个人习惯来创建针对性的字典:

  1. 时间线索法:如果记得大概的创建时间,围绕那个时间段生成密码
  2. 内容关联法:根据文件名、文件夹名推测可能的密码
  3. 习惯分析法:回忆自己常用的密码模式和习惯

分阶段测试策略

第一阶段:测试简单密码(6位以内,纯数字)第二阶段:测试常用组合(姓名+生日等)第三阶段:测试复杂密码(8位以上,混合字符)

🎭 用户故事:真实案例分享

案例1:找回10年前的毕业照片

张先生找到了大学时的加密照片压缩包,完全忘记了密码。使用ArchivePasswordTestTool后:

  • 根据学号和入学年份创建字典
  • 20分钟内成功找回密码
  • 重拾珍贵青春回忆

案例2:恢复离职同事的工作文档

李经理接手项目时发现关键文档被加密:

  • 收集公司常用密码规则
  • 结合项目名称和日期
  • 45分钟解锁所有文件

📈 效率对比:传统vs现代方法

手动尝试:1个密码/分钟 → 1000个密码需要16.7小时 ArchivePasswordTestTool:1000个密码/分钟 → 1000个密码仅需1分钟

效率提升1600%!这就是自动化工具的力量!

🛠️ 进阶技巧:批量处理与自动化

批量处理脚本示例

#!/bin/bash # 批量测试当前目录下所有加密文件 for file in *.zip *.rar *.7z; do echo "正在处理: $file" dotnet run --project ArchivePasswordTestTool/ArchivePasswordTestTool.csproj \ -- --target "$file" \ --dictionary "我的密码字典.txt" done

定期密码强度测试

建议每季度使用这个工具测试自己重要文件的密码:

  • 验证密码是否还记得
  • 检查密码强度是否足够
  • 及时更新弱密码

🔐 安全使用原则

合法合规第一

  • 仅用于恢复自己拥有合法权限的文件
  • 不得用于破解他人加密文件
  • 遵守当地法律法规

数据安全保护

  • 测试过程不修改原始文件
  • 临时文件自动清理
  • 敏感信息本地处理不外传

🚀 下一步行动:立即开始使用!

今日行动计划:

  1. 下载工具:克隆项目到本地
  2. 准备测试:找一个自己加密但记得密码的文件练习
  3. 创建字典:基于个人信息创建第一个密码字典
  4. 首次尝试:运行工具体验快速恢复

长期建议:

  • 建立个人密码管理习惯
  • 定期备份重要密码
  • 分享使用经验给有需要的朋友

🌟 总结:为什么选择ArchivePasswordTestTool?

ArchivePasswordTestTool不仅仅是一个工具,它是你数据安全的守护者!通过智能化的密码测试策略和优化的资源管理,它为你提供了一种可靠、高效、免费的数据恢复解决方案。

记住:预防总比恢复好,但有了ArchivePasswordTestTool,即使忘记了密码也不再是灾难!

立即开始你的密码恢复之旅吧!🎉

小提示:成功找回密码后,建议立即将密码记录在安全的密码管理器中,避免再次遗忘哦!

【免费下载链接】ArchivePasswordTestTool利用7zip测试压缩包的功能 对加密压缩包进行自动化测试密码项目地址: https://gitcode.com/gh_mirrors/ar/ArchivePasswordTestTool

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/590837/

相关文章:

  • UDOP-large实战案例:英文项目计划书→Extract timeline and milestones.
  • GitHub下载加速终极解决方案:3分钟告别龟速下载,效率提升300%
  • WarcraftHelper优化工具:告别魔兽争霸III兼容性困扰,让经典游戏重获新生
  • 大麦网抢票脚本终极指南:3分钟快速部署Python自动化抢票方案
  • OpenClaw夜间自动化:千问3.5-35B-A3B-FP8实现7*24小时数据监控
  • WeKnora教育科技:Matlab教学资源智能推荐
  • 解决oracle IMP工具导入dmp文件 IMP-00033: Warning: Table “...“ not found in export file 错误
  • 操作系统原理视角下的Graphormer模型推理性能调优
  • 【源码深度】Android View绘制流程全解析|吃透measure、layout、draw三大流程与UI卡顿优化|Android全栈体系150讲-10
  • 移动安全实验室:用Unidbg动态分析小红书核心加密协议(附Hook脚本)
  • FireRedASR Pro在软件测试中的应用:语音交互功能自动化测试
  • 突破音乐格式壁垒:QMCDecode实现QQ音乐加密文件跨平台播放的完整方案
  • 数据分析之数据粒度(Granularity)
  • 若依框架分页实践:避开PageHelper与PageInfo的常见陷阱
  • mootdx:金融数据接口零代码解决方案,让财务分析效率提升10倍
  • DDR内存工作原理详解:从Bank Group到突发传输的实战指南
  • Redis数据类型与命令速查手册:从字符串到有序集合的实战操作
  • 终极指南:如何用UABEA轻松处理Unity资源包
  • 抖音批量下载工具:5分钟搞定视频、音乐、直播内容保存
  • 数字游民必备!bge-large-zh-v1.5云端部署,轻薄本也能跑大模型
  • DeepSeek-OCR-2网络协议分析:从HTTP到gRPC性能对比
  • 3分钟掌握抖音无水印批量下载:开源工具终极解决方案
  • 像素史诗惊艳UI细节:金币黄按钮悬停反馈+硬阴影切换的CSS实现教程
  • 别再只会用RC了!从电源噪声到音频处理,聊聊LC、有源滤波器的实战选型心得
  • 暗黑3按键助手终极指南:5分钟配置,彻底告别手酸烦恼
  • 旧iOS设备复活指南:让你的iPhone/iPad重获新生
  • 终极文档下载指南:kill-doc浏览器脚本快速突破文档获取限制
  • 3步彻底解决显卡驱动残留:Display Driver Uninstaller深度应用指南
  • granite-4.0-h-350m快速上手:Ollama交互式会话与退出方法
  • iOS虚拟定位安全实现指南:iFakeLocation跨平台解决方案